Transaction 572857948f71faeb1da2c28a6177a4546100dc056fe54ffe900975f6ac2b2fbe

4 Input
1 Outputs
  • 572857948f71faeb1da2c28a6177a4546100dc056fe54ffe900975f6ac2b2fbe:0
  • value  170313
    address  12V7XzNX2AX4rg7a592ag2EVtGwkVx3TSh